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2023-01-24 Committee on Appropriations and Financial Affairs suggested and ordered printed.
  • 2023-01-24 The Bill was REFERRED to the Committee on APPROPRIATIONS AND FINANCIAL AFFAIRS. referral-committee
  • 2023-01-24 Sent for conc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-01-24 The Bill was REFERRED to the Committee on APPROPRIATIONS AND FINANCIAL AFFAIRS in concurrence referral-committee
  • 2023-03-30 Carried over, in the same posture, to any special or regular session of the 131st Legislature, pursuant to Joint Order SP 594.
  • 2023-07-06 Reports READ.
  • 2023-07-06 On motion of Representative SACHS of Freeport, the Majority Ought to Pass as Amended Report was ACCEPTED.
  • 2023-07-06 ROLL CALL NO. 350
  • 2023-07-06 (Yeas 80 - Nays 58 - Absent 13 - Excused 0)
  • 2023-07-06 The Bill was READ ONCE. reading-1
  • 2023-07-06 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) was READ.
  • 2023-07-06 On motion of Representative SACHS of Freeport, House Amendment "A" (H-721) to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) was READ and ADOPTED. committee-passage-favorable, passage
  • 2023-07-06 On motion of Representative SACHS of Freeport, House Amendment "B" (H-722) to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) was READ and ADOPTED. committee-passage-favorable, passage
  • 2023-07-06 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) as Amended by House Amendment "A" (H-721) and House Amendment "B" (H-722) thereto was ADOPTED. committ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-06 Under suspension of the rules, the Bill was given its SECOND READING without REFERENCE to the Committee on Bills in the Second Reading.
  • 2023-07-06 The Bill was P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ED as Amended by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) as Amended by House Amendment "A" (H-721) and House Amendment "B" (H-722) thereto. reading-3
  • 2023-07-06 Sent for conc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-07-06 Reports Read
  • 2023-07-06 On motion by Senator ROTUNDO of Androscoggin the Majority Ought to Pass as Amended Report ACCEPTED.
  • 2023-07-06 Roll Call Ordered Roll Call Number 478 Yeas 22 - Nays 9 - Excused 4 - Absent 0 PREVAILED
  • 2023-07-06 READ ONCE reading-1
  • 2023-07-06 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) READ
  • 2023-07-06 House Amendment "A" (H-721) to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) READ and 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-06 House Amendment "B" (H-722) to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) READ and 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-06 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) as Amended by House Amendment "A" (H-721) AND House Amendment "B" (H-722) thereto ADOPTED committee-passage-favorable
  • 2023-07-06 Under suspension of the Rules, READ A SECOND TIME and PASSED TO BE ENGROSSED AS AMENDED by Committee Amendment "A" (H-717) as Amended by House Amendment "A" (H-721) AND House Amendment "B" (H-722) thereto in concurrence reading-2, reading-3
  • 2023-07-06 PASSED TO BE ENACTED. passage
  • 2023-07-06 Sent for concurrence. ORDERED SENT FORTHWITH.
  • 2023-07-06 PASSED TO BE ENACTED, in concurrence. passage
  • 2023-07-06 Roll Call Ordered Roll Call Number 484 Yeas 22 - Nays 9 - Excused 4 - Absent 0 PREVAILED
  • 2023-07-11 Signed by Governor executive-signature
